The reactor is used for lab scale research for BHET, that would esterficated with EG and PTA.
ᆞ Equipped with magnetic stirrer, motor, reducer. 
ᆞ The inner cylinder and head are made of stainless steel S31603, the flange and jacket are made of stainless steel S30408, and other materials in contact with the kettle are made of stainless steel S31603. 
ᆞ All butt welds on the inner wall of the container should be polished flat, fillet welds should be polished smooth, and the inner wall and parts contacting materials should be polished. 
ᆞ Electrostatic grounding
Title of product Features
Exproof and high sealing feature:
Both the reactant and product are flammable, so the high sealing and explosion proof features are applied for the parts. 
ᆞ The flanges is of SO type, which has high sealing effect than PL flange. 
ᆞ The main flanges for the reactor is equiped with the metal wound gasket, that could maintain high sealing and withstand high temperature at the same time.
ᆞ The contacting surface of all the flanges are RF type to ensure a good sealing performance.
Large troque:
The mixture of EG , PTA and BHET of high viscosity. In order to make the uniform mixing, the anchor type of blade is needed. Besides, the high strring speed is also required. So, a large torque is needed.
ᆞ We use a larger magnetic sealing shaft sleeve coupler which has a pack of magnetic steel to offer high torque. 
ᆞ Accordingly, a motor with large power is also applied to run the stirrer.
ᆞ The axis diameter is as large as 22mm, which could withstand the forced caused by large torque.
Vacuum requirement:
The vacuum process is needed to be done before and after the esterification within the reactor kettle.
ᆞ Before the reaction:
The vacuum is to used to expel the air inside the kettle. Or, the medium will react with the oxigen. 
 After the reaction:
It is used to reduce the pressure within the kettle. The boiling point of the medium will be reduced accordingly. Then it is no need to keep increasing the temprature.  And the removing of BHET could stop the reversing of esterification.
High temperature feature:
Because of the esterfication of EG and PTA needs high work temperature up to 320°C. 
In order to start the esterfication, the kettle will be heated by the jacket wrapping outside. The thermal medium is inject to the inlet of the jacket from the constant temeparture circulation tank.
After the heat release to kettle, the thermal medium will be back to the circulation tank for heating via the outlet of the jacket.
